Hematite is an opaque mineral composed of iron oxides. Its name has Greek origins, derived from the red, blood-like powder that appears during processing. It features a metallic luster and varies in color from lead-gray and silver to black. With a hardness of 6.5 and a specific gravity of 5.05, hematite has been used in jewelry-making since as early as 3000 B.C.
